What does a reliable hardware design partner actually do?
A hardware design partner manages the full development lifecycle of a physical electronic product, covering schematic design, PCB layout, firmware development, prototyping, compliance testing, certification, and manufacturing support. The most capable partners operate as a single integrated team rather than a chain of separate vendors, eliminating handoff risks and reducing time to market.

What is the difference between a hardware design partner and a contract manufacturer?
A hardware design partner provides engineering expertise across the entire product development cycle, including architecture, design, and certification, while a contract manufacturer focuses primarily on producing an already-finalized design at scale. The most valuable partners bridge both functions, supporting low-volume production and manufacturing readiness as part of the same engagement.
